Art Historical Context
Behold the exquisite *Immortals in Clouds* (云中仙人漆柄团扇), a Qing dynasty fan painting by Chen Yongqi from 1894, now housed in the Art Institute of Chicago's Arts of Asia collection. Crafted with ink and vibrant colors on luxurious gilded paper, mounted on a slender bamboo handle, this 25.3 × 26 cm artwork (41.3 cm with handle) exemplifies the refined artistry of late imperial China. Fans like this were not mere utilitarian objects but cherished possessions—portable canvases for poetry, calligraphy, and scenes of the divine, often gifted among scholars and elites.
